District Road
District Road is situated on a working farm just outside the village of Himeville, in the Southern Drakensberg. Accommodation consists of self-catering cottages and rooms for couples or solo travellers. Features lovely gardens and freshwater dams. The Farm has superb views into Lesotho with Hodgson's Peaks very prominent on clear days. Located just outside Himeville along the scenic Sani Pass Road, District Road is a picturesque destination set against the dramatic backdrop of the Southern Drakensberg. This sheep and cattle farm has evolved into a vibrant sanctuary where guests can immerse themselves in mountain life. Whether visiting for a quiet retreat or a major event like the Glencairn Trail Run, the farm offers a welcoming atmosphere where animals like zebras, eland, and horses roam freely across the grasslands and near the lake. The accommodation is designed to cater to various group sizes and preferences, blending modern comfort with rustic charm. Guests can choose between sleek rooms and stone cottages to comfortably accommodate solo travellers, couples, or families or groups. The cottages include a well-equipped kitchenette and cosy lounge areas, some with fireplaces. All units have private bathrooms and patios with garden views. Beyond the comfortable rooms, the farm functions as a complete outdoor playground. The Pholela River and the expansive lake provide ample opportunity for fly-fishing, canoeing, and tubing, while the well-maintained trails are perfect for mountain biking, hiking, and trail running. On-site facilities include a "chill zone" in the main barn, a bar, and communal braai areas, making it easy to socialise. For a touch of luxury after a day of exploration, guests can even book on-site massages, ensuring a perfectly balanced stay in the heart of the Berg.
